Tailored Treatments for Bulimia: Affect and Eating Insights

In a groundbreaking study published in the Journal of Eating Disorders, researchers Lim, K.O., Kummerfeld, E., and Anderson, L.M., along with their team, embark on an exploration into the nuanced interplay of emotional states and eating behaviors in individuals suffering from bulimia nervosa. Their innovative approach utilizes personal causal modeling to uncover the intricate chains of cause and effect linking emotions to eating habits. The implications of this research extend far beyond mere observation; they suggest pathways for more tailored and effective treatment strategies for those grappling with this complex eating disorder.

Bulimia nervosa has long posed a significant challenge in the realm of mental health, intertwining psychological, biological, and social factors. Individuals with bulimia often experience cycles of binge eating followed by purging, often fueled by intense emotional states. The recurrence of these behaviors can be perplexing, especially as traditional approaches to treatment can feel disjointed from the personal experiences of those affected. This research addresses that divide, leveraging personal causal modeling as a sophisticated tool to visualize these relational dynamics.

Personal causal modeling, at its core, offers a means to represent how various factors influence one another in individual contexts. It allows researchers to create linear and non-linear models that can illustrate the impact of certain emotions on eating behaviors and how these behaviors can, in turn, affect subsequent emotional states. In their study, the authors explicitly focus on collecting high-resolution data that encapsulates individual experiences, painting a rich picture of how emotional fluctuations could potentially trigger episodes of binge eating or purging.

The researchers employed advanced statistical techniques and machine learning algorithms to analyze data collected from participants over time. This approach not only identifies key emotional triggers related to binge-eating episodes but also highlights the reciprocal nature of these relationships. For instance, certain emotions may lead to unhealthy eating patterns, which in turn exacerbate those same emotions, creating a vicious cycle that can be challenging to break.

An essential aspect of this research is its commitment to personalization in treatment strategies. By understanding the individual psychological profiles of participants and their unique eating behavior patterns, the findings suggest that treatment can be more effectively designed. Traditional methods often apply a one-size-fits-all model, but with personal causal modeling, therapists can tailor interventions that resonate more deeply with the lived experiences of those they aim to help.

As the study reveals, emotional awareness plays a crucial role in breaking the cycle of bulimia nervosa. By identifying specific emotions tied to binge-eating episodes, therapists can work with individuals to develop healthier coping mechanisms. Instead of turning to food as a source of comfort, patients might be encouraged to address their triggers through alternative methods such as mindfulness practices, emotional regulation strategies, or cognitive-behavioral techniques.

One particularly compelling aspect of this research is the potential for real-time monitoring of emotions and behaviors using wearable technology. Imagine a future where individuals struggling with bulimia can utilize apps or devices that collect data on their emotional states throughout the day. This data could feed into personal causal models that provide instant feedback and advice, helping individuals navigate their behaviors and emotions as they occur, rather than relying solely on retrospective insights.

Subject of Research: Bulimia nervosa and the interplay of emotions and eating behaviors using personal causal modeling.

Article Title: Personal causal modeling of affect and eating behaviors in bulimia nervosa: implications for personalized treatment.

Article References: Lim, K.O., Kummerfeld, E., Anderson, L.M. et al. Personal causal modeling of affect and eating behaviors in bulimia nervosa: implications for personalized treatment. J Eat Disord (2026). https://doi.org/10.1186/s40337-026-01524-x
